Brick Hardscape Construction in Greenwich, CT
Brick hardscape construction involves the installation and design of durable, aesthetically appealing features using brick materials. This service covers a variety of proj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and garden borders.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ance outdoor living spaces, improve property curb appeal, or create functional areas for activities and gatherings. Before requesting brick hardscape work, property owners should consider factors like the intended use of the space, drainage requirements, and the overall style or pattern desired for the brick layout.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ential, including the size and location of the installation, as well as any existing structures that may need to be integrated or removed. It's also helpful to be aware of the types of brick materials available, maintenance considerations, and how the design complements the property's overall aesthetic. Clear communication about expectations and desired outcomes can help ensure the finished hardscape aligns with the property owner’s vision and functional needs.

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scape construction?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are commonly used in brick hardscape construction? Standard materials include clay bricks, concrete bricks, and pavers designed for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does a typical brick hardscape installation take? The duration varies based on project size and complexity, but installations generally range from a few days to a week.
What should property owners consider before starting a brick hardscape project? It’s important to assess the site’s foundation, drainage, and design preferences to ensure a successful outcome.
